SMIGNN: social recommendation with multi-intention knowledge distillation based on graph neural network

被引:1
|
作者
Niu, Yong [1 ]
Xing, Xing [1 ,2 ]
Jia, Zhichun [2 ]
Xin, Mindong [1 ]
Xing, Junye [2 ]
机构
[1] Bohai Univ, Network Informat Ctr, Jinzhou 121013, Liaoning, Peoples R China
[2] Bohai Univ, Coll Informat Sci & Technol, Jinzhou 121013, Liaoning, Peoples R China
来源
JOURNAL OF SUPERCOMPUTING | 2024年 / 80卷 / 05期
基金
中国国家自然科学基金;
关键词
Social network; Graph neural network; Recommendation system; Knowledge distillation; User intents;
D O I
10.1007/s11227-023-05720-3
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Social recommendation based on user preference aims to make use of user interaction information and mine user's fine-grained preferences for item prediction. However, existing methods have not explored the differences in intentions between various user interactions, and they do not sufficiently model the user social graph and user item graph. In order to solve the above problems, this paper proposes a novel social recommendation model. It utilizes graph neural network to construct separate models for user social model and user item model, capturing multiple intents that drive user preferences. We use node attention and intention attention to calculate feature weights separately to obtain rich features of users and items. To increase the information dissemination between models and improve their overall predictive ability, we introduce knowledge distillation technology. The specific design is to combine the user's dual graph as the teacher model and transfer knowledge to the student model of a single user graph separately. Subsequently, the model is optimized for item recommendation prediction by calculating both the basic loss and distillation loss using the cross-entropy function. Experiments are conducted on Yelp and Ciao datasets, and the results achieve good predictive performance, which has demonstrated the effectiveness of the proposed method.
引用
收藏
页码:6965 / 6988
页数:24
相关论文
共 50 条
  • [41] A graph neural network-based teammate recommendation model for knowledge-intensive crowdsourcing
    Zhang, Zhenyu
    Yao, Wenxin
    Li, Fangzheng
    Yu, Jiayan
    Simic, Vladimir
    Yin, Xicheng
    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2024, 137
  • [42] Meta graph network recommendation based on multi-behavior encoding
    Liu, Xiaoyang
    Xiao, Wei
    Liu, Chao
    Wang, Wei
    Li, Chaorong
    JOURNAL OF KING SAUD UNIVERSITY-COMPUTER AND INFORMATION SCIENCES, 2024, 36 (05)
  • [43] Dynamic global structure enhanced multi-channel graph neural network for session-based recommendation
    Zhu, Xiaofei
    Tang, Gu
    Wang, Pengfei
    Li, Chenliang
    Guo, Jiafeng
    Dietze, Stefan
    INFORMATION SCIENCES, 2023, 624 : 324 - 343
  • [44] High-Order Social Graph Neural Network for Service Recommendation
    Wei, Chunyu
    Fan, Yushun
    Zhang, Jia
    I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2022, 19 (04): : 4615 - 4628
  • [45] Basket Recommendation with Multi-Intent Translation Graph Neural Network
    Liu, Zhiwei
    Li, Xiaohan
    Fan, Ziwei
    Guo, Stephen
    Achan, Kannan
    Yu, Philip S.
    2020 IEEE INTERNATIONAL CONFERENCE ON BIG DATA (BIG DATA), 2020, : 728 - 737
  • [46] Heterogeneous propagation graph convolution network for a recommendation system based on a knowledge graph
    Lu, Jiawei
    Li, Jiapeng
    Li, Wenhui
    Song, Junfeng
    Xiao, Gang
    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2024, 138
  • [47] UAV Edge Caching Content Recommendation Algorithm Based on Graph Neural Network
    Wang, Wei
    Xing, Longxing
    Xu, Na
    Su, Jiatao
    Su, Wenting
    Cao, Jiarong
    INTERNATIONAL JOURNAL OF DIGITAL CRIME AND FORENSICS, 2023, 15 (01)
  • [48] Graph Neural Networks for Social Recommendation
    Fan, Wenqi
    Ma, Yao
    Li, Qing
    He, Yuan
    Zhao, Eric
    Tang, Jiliang
    Yin, Dawei
    WEB CONFERENCE 2019: PROCEEDINGS OF THE WORLD WIDE WEB CONFERENCE (WWW 2019), 2019, : 417 - 426
  • [49] Robust social recommendation based on contrastive learning and dual-stage graph neural network
    Ma, Gang-Feng
    Yang, Xu-Hua
    Long, Haixia
    Zhou, Yanbo
    Xu, Xin-Li
    NEUROCOMPUTING, 2024, 584
  • [50] Multi-behavior aware service recommendation based on hypergraph graph convolution neural network
    Lu J.-W.
    Li D.-N.
    Wang C.-C.
    Xu J.
    Xiao G.
    Zhejiang Daxue Xuebao (Gongxue Ban)/Journal of Zhejiang University (Engineering Science), 2023, 57 (10): : 1977 - 1986